summerStudents who attend a Boulder culinary school should make sure to be involved in the community they may one day be working as a chef in. A fun way to do this is to participate in the events that are happening in Colorado. While you might have to make a trip to Denver or another city or town, chances are you’ll enjoy whatever event you attend. Colorado is home to many fun and exciting food and beverage events, and summer is the best time to experience them.

Cherry Creek North Food and Wine Festival
This year’s Cherry Creek North Food and Wine Festival will be held at the Filmore Plaza on the corner of Filmore Street and 2nd Avenue in Denver from 6 to 9 p.m. on Aug. 9. At the festival you can expect fine wine, craft beer and spirits. There will be food from a variety of vendors and live music. Vendors include Aviano, Blue Island Oyster, Opus, So Perfect Eats, True Food Kitchen, Harman’s Eat & Drink, Second Home Kitchen & Bar and many more. You can be sure you’ll enjoy yourself and you’ll be able to take home a commemorative wine glass to remember the evening.

Dining Al Fresco
Another great event to go to in Denver is Dining Al Fresco. At this event, held in Larimer Square on Aug. 15 starting at 5 p.m., the restaurants that call the square home will lengthen their patios out into the street so customers can eat and enjoy the square without the bustle of traffic. Restaurants participating include The Capital Grille, Bistro Vendôme, Corridor 44, The Crimson Room, Russell’s Smokehouse, Osteria Marco and several others. If you wish to participate in this event all you’ll need to do is place a reservation with one of the participating restaurants.

Guest chef dinner event with Marc Vetri
If you’re looking for something close, look no further than Frasco Food & Wine on Aug. 26 at 5 p.m. Frasco Food & Wine, on Pearl St. in the heart of Boulder, will host guest chef Marc Vetri. Vetri is the chef and founder of Philadelphia’s Vetri Family of Restaurants and is the author of the cookbook “Mastering Pasta.” The event will last all night, but if you wish to attend you should consider making a reservation.

Colorado state fair
Although not necessarily a food and beverage event, the Colorado state fair will be full of food vendors and is a great event for all ages. Here you’ll find some of the tastiest and most unhealthy fried foods you can get your hands on. You can get anything from your typical onion rings to fried Oreo cookies, cheesecake and peanut butter. This year’s state fair is in Pueblo, Colorado, and although it’s a bit of a drive, you can be sure that you’ll enjoy yourself once you get there. The fair will last from Aug. 28 through Sep. 7 and will feature a number of musical artists, events, carnival rides and much more.
